Transaction f80fea70cedcedca598b2d7b4be232cae2a9001ae943edb16b6ff94fabf56791

29 Input
1 Outputs
  • f80fea70cedcedca598b2d7b4be232cae2a9001ae943edb16b6ff94fabf56791:0
  • value  28990000
    address  tb1qmexyc2rmgdyg9utp7np9rlga4mkm4n6gz9pw5ucep9gl2zxv5smslh55py